One of my favorite breweries. Great variety of beers on tap with crowler and growler fills. Wide open and spacious inside with awesome and friendly staff. No food available except snack food but a rotating food truck menu with outside carry in also. Great place for a beer!

(Ssn) IPA 4.8abv excellent, great hop up front and back some bitter on the finish (wow the best Session all week) 16oz ; (isolated West Coast) IPA 6.8abv very good, again nice hop up front and back some bitter on the finish (for a WC it should have a touch more pine and bitter) 16oz ;- good WiFi , some outdoor seating , no Pils Brown or Pale Ale today , 14 beer type things on tap today (4 are Belgo adjunct malt beverages) , good parking ,(2018) Pale Ale-64 6.0abv good but over hopped needs a touch more bitter ; Brnr-IPA 5.6abv pretty good cloudy NE style ; Ses-IPA pretty good 6.0abv a bit too high.- finger food only , right on the street, a bit too IPA centric ,
